WiFi
文章平均质量分 56
WiFi
Li-Yongjun
这个作者很懒,什么都没留下…
展开
-
WiFi 四地址帧
DA 和 SA 是一对,RA 和 TA 是一对。原创 2023-04-27 22:15:00 · 1634 阅读 · 0 评论 -
ubuntu14.04 AR5B22 无线网卡连不上 AP 问题解决
原来是 wpa_supplicant 进程的问题。原创 2022-07-05 13:22:20 · 1885 阅读 · 1 评论 -
使用 wpa_supplicant 连接 WiFi
连接家里的 WiFi 上网原创 2022-06-01 23:54:29 · 5128 阅读 · 0 评论 -
ESP8266 + MAX7219 制作 WiFi 数字时钟
没有外壳,买了点小积木自己组装。原创 2022-04-23 14:10:37 · 3695 阅读 · 9 评论 -
WiFi 的认证方法
认证方法有两种:Open system authentication 与 Shared key authentication。原创 2021-09-29 11:32:49 · 28803 阅读 · 4 评论 -
抠门的 WiFi 芯片厂家,抠门的程序员
正是这些抠门造就了这么多伟大的成就,不是吗?原创 2021-09-25 15:18:42 · 13880 阅读 · 20 评论 -
mt7615 配置选项介绍
DefaultCountryRegion=5 // 2.4G国家区域,如果 eeprom 里面已经有了,此处不起作用。地区不同,使用的信道范围也不同,5:1-14 all active scanCountryRegionABand=7 // 5G 国家区域,36、40、44、48、……、161、165CountryCode=US // 设置国家码DBDC_MODE=0BssidNum=1SSID= // 设置 AP SSIDSSID1=RTDEV_AP5g_123SSID2=原创 2021-02-24 20:10:02 · 13257 阅读 · 0 评论 -
mt7615 datapath
module_init(rt_pci_init_module) rt_pci_init_module() pci_module_init(&rt_pci_driver); probe: rt_pci_probe, rt_pci_probe() /*PCIDevInit============================================== */ pci_enable_device() pci_set_dma_mask()原创 2021-02-24 19:52:34 · 10271 阅读 · 0 评论 -
ifconfig datapath (WiFi 接口)
DataPath参考浅谈/proc/net/dev的由来原创 2021-01-26 09:58:04 · 10002 阅读 · 0 评论 -
Wi-Fi 6
# 小米10发布会2020年2月13日,小米10发布会上提到了一项技术——Wi-Fi 6。并配套推出了支持Wi-Fi 6功能的小米AIoT路由器AX3600(手机和路由器同时支持Wi-Fi 6,才能发挥出Wi-Fi 6的威力)。# 何为Wi-Fi 6 ?IEEE 802.11ax,Wi-Fi联盟基于该标准的行业认证标准称之为Wi-Fi 6,在全球普及推广。## 何为 IEEE 802...原创 2020-03-08 23:45:31 · 10596 阅读 · 2 评论 -
WiFi 基础(六)—— 认证和加密原理
认证和加密WiFi 连接过程其实主要就做了两件事:身份认证和密钥交换为什么要进行身份认证为了只让特定(合法)用户使用当前网络为什么要进行密钥交换为了使用加密的方式进行通信,防止通信信息被第三方截获破解导致隐私泄露如何进行身份认证只要让 AP 知道 STA 中储存的密码是否和自己的密码相等就可以了。最简单的办法:拿到 STA 的密码。AP 将其和自己的密码进行比对,相等则代表该 STA 是合法用户,应当准许接入网络,否则,应当拒绝接入。AP 怎样拿到 STA 的密码呢?1:STA 将密码明文传原创 2020-09-20 04:43:12 · 15284 阅读 · 0 评论 -
WiFi 基础(五)—— 收包状态机
原创 2020-09-20 04:41:00 · 10568 阅读 · 0 评论 -
WiFi 基础(四)—— 连接过程
连接三步骤扫描(Probe Request、Probe Response)认证(Authentication)关联(Association Request、Association Response)1. 扫描阶段STA 发送 Probe Req 帧,携带 SSID 表明欲加入的网络,携带 Supported Rates 表明自身的能力。AP 回复 Probe Rsp 帧,这是 AP 的义务,(AP 允许此 STA 连接的情况下)也携带 Supported Rates 表明自身的能力。作用:原创 2020-09-20 04:38:52 · 29731 阅读 · 9 评论 -
WiFi 基础(三)—— 管理帧介绍
原创 2020-09-20 04:34:41 · 11845 阅读 · 0 评论 -
WiFi 基础(二)—— BSS、ESS、BSSID、ESSID、SSID
BSSBasic Service Set 基本服务组合,一个热点的覆盖范围被称为一个 BSS。由一组彼此通信的工作站所构成。工作站之间的通信,在某个模糊地带进行,称为基本服务区域(basic service area),此区域受限于所使用无线介质的传播特性。只要位于基本服务区域,工作站就可以跟同一个 BSS 的其他成员通信。BSS 分为两种常见的、家庭中使用的基本是基础型 BSS,我们也只讨论基础型 BSS。ESSExtended Service Set 延伸式服务组合,基站允许个别的 BS原创 2020-09-20 04:28:50 · 37800 阅读 · 1 评论 -
Wi-Fi 命令大全
# iwlist用于对 /proc/net/wireless 文件进行分析,得出无线网卡相关信息# iwlist wlan0 scanning 搜索当前无线网络# iwlist wlan0 frequen 显示频道信息# iwlist wlan0 rate 显示连接速度# iwlist wlan0 power 显示电源模式# iwlist wlan0 txpower 显示功...原创 2020-04-19 00:03:05 · 15956 阅读 · 2 评论 -
WiFi 基础(一)—— 名词介绍
缩写全称中文全称解释备注APAccess Point接入点 (基站)具备无线至有线(wireless-to-wired)桥接功能的设备称为基站。基站的功能不仅于此,但桥接(bridging)最为重要。AP 本身也是一个 STA,只不过它还能为那些已经关联的(associated)STA 提供分布式服务。STAStation工作站配备无线网络界面的计算机设备携带无线网络接口卡的设备-BSSBasic service set基本...原创 2020-09-20 04:22:33 · 12260 阅读 · 0 评论 -
Android 手机修改 WiFi MAC 地址
# 场景最近在测 WiFi,需要对 WiFi 进行抓包,而我使用的 STA 为一部 Android 手机,发现手机的 MAC 地址经常变动,对抓包造成了不便。# 需求因此萌生了修改手机 MAC 的想法,使其固定。# 原理Android 手机,WiFi 的配置文件为 /data/nvram/APCFG/APRDEB/WIFI注:上述示例是 MEIZU MX5, Android 版本 5.1 中的路径。不同厂商的 Android 系统,路径可能会有所不同。修改此配置文件,就可以修改 WiFi原创 2020-10-27 11:08:49 · 23969 阅读 · 1 评论